python串連資料庫

標籤:# -*- coding: utf-8 -*-‘‘‘Created on 2015-03-19Mysql 資料庫連接類‘‘‘import MySQLdbclass DBOperate: dbhandle = None #建立和資料庫系統的串連 def connect(self): self.dbhandle = MySQLdb.connect("localhost","username","password","dbname" ) #擷取操作遊標

python之資料庫支援

標籤:資料庫系統   python   except   安全性   版本號碼   13.1.1 全域變數任何支援2.0版本DB

Python + Matplotlib 繪製 Penrose 鋪砌

標籤:效果是不是很漂亮呢?  代碼如下:  #-----------------------------------------# Python + Matplotlib 繪製 Penrose 鋪砌# by Zhao Liang [email protected]#-----------------------------------------import matplotlib.pyplot as pltimport numpy as npfrom

用python qt4搞了個複製檔案介面

標籤:下面是部份代碼:# -*- coding: utf-8 -*-from PyQt4.QtCore import pyqtSignaturefrom PyQt4.QtGui import QDialogfrom PyQt4 import QtCore,QtGuifrom Ui_copyfile import Ui_copyfileimport shutilimport osclass copyfile(QDialog, Ui_copyfile): """ Class

python之網路編程

標籤:網路編程   伺服器   python   客戶機   listen   14.1.1

python之全球資訊網

標籤:python   原始碼   import   運算式   全球資訊網   15.1 螢幕抓取螢幕抓取是程式下載網頁並且提取資訊的過程。簡單的螢幕抓取程式from urllib import urlopenimport rep = re.compile(‘<h3><a .*?><a .*? href="(.*?)

python之測試

標籤:python   測試   16.1先測試 後編碼16.1.1 精確的需求說明16.1.2 為改變而計劃覆蓋度是測試知識中重要的部分。,優秀的測試程式組的目標之一是擁有良好的覆蓋度,實現這個目標的方法之一是使用覆蓋度工具16.2測試載入器其中有兩個很棒的模組可以協助你自動完成測試過程:1.unitest:通用測試架構2.doctest:簡單一些的模組,是檢查文檔用的,但是對於編寫單元測試也很在行。16.2.1 doctest例如

python之擴充

標籤:python   import   public   編譯器   產生器   17.2 非常簡單的途徑:Jython 和 IronPython一個簡單的java類public class JythonTest{public void

python通過POST提交頁面請求

標籤:原文:http://blog.csdn.net/liyzh_inspur/article/details/6294292 import urllibimport urllib2url = ‘http://umbra.nascom.nasa.gov/cgi-bin/eit-catalog.cgi‘values = {‘obs_year‘:‘2011‘,‘obs_month‘:‘March‘,

python之程式打包

標籤:python   原始碼   打包   18.1 Distutils基礎Distutils安裝指令碼from distutils.core import setupsetup(name=‘Hello‘,version=‘1.0‘,description=‘A simple example‘,author=‘Magnus Lie

Python迴圈定時服務功能(類似contrab)

標籤:定時器   timer   python   contrab   迴圈   Python實現的迴圈定時服務功能,類似於Linux下的contrab功能。主要通過定時器實現。註:Python中的threading.timer是基於線程實現的,每次定時事件產生時,回調完響應函數後線程就結束。而Python中的線程是不能restart

【譯】Python中如何建立mock?

標籤:原文地址:http://engineroom.trackmaven.com/blog/making-a-mockery-of-python/ 今天我們來談論下mock的使用。當然,請不要誤會,這裡的mock可不是嘲弄的意思。mock是一門技術,通過偽造部分實際代碼,從而讓我們能夠驗證剩餘代碼的正確性。現在我們將通過幾個簡單的樣本示範mock在Python測試代碼中的使用,以及這項極其有用的技術是如何協助我們改善測試代碼的。 為什麼我們需要mock?

Python模組學習筆記— —random

標籤:python   random   Python中的random模組用於產生隨機數。random.random函數原型 random.random() 產生一個範圍在[0,1)的隨機浮點數。import randomprint random.random()random.uniform函數原型 random.uniform(a,b) 產生一個指定範圍內的隨機浮點數,兩個參數一個是上限,一個是下限。如果a >

Python學習筆記(1)

標籤:1. 求50到100之間的素數import mathfor i in range(50,100+1): for j in range(2,int(math.sqrt(i))+1): if i%j==0: break else: print(i)View Code2. 求一元二次方程的解:ax2+bx+c=0import mathdef quad(a,b,c): if not

python twisted socket 服務端 用戶端

標籤:使用twisted搭建socket的伺服器,並能給用戶端發送訊息, 比較簡單,直接上代碼 #coding=utf-8‘‘‘用於實現給響應用戶端的請求,並且可以給客戶發送訊息,‘‘‘from twisted.internet import reactorfrom twisted.internet.protocol import Protocol, Factoryimport timeimport thread#線程體,def timer(no, interval):  

Python:List、tuple、dict、set

標籤:list是一種有序的集合,可以隨時添加和刪除其中的元素。>>> s = [‘python‘, ‘java‘, [‘asp‘, ‘php‘], ‘scheme‘]>>> s[2][1]‘php‘tuple和list類似,但是tuple一旦初始化就不能修改>>> t = (1,2,3)>>> t[2]3dict,也就是其Java中的map,使用鍵-值(key-value)儲存。>>> d =

vs 2013上Python的配置

標籤:http://www.cnblogs.com/guoming0000/archive/2012/06/13/2548350.html 最近有點不務正業,去看了下Python(主要是學校OJ有這個語言,然後可以輕鬆解決大資料問題,不要說我太坑~~~)目前感覺python和matlab有些類似,缺少了變數型別宣告,總感覺自己寫出來的代碼有些難看。好的,第一次,自然是安裝python,由於我一直使用vs2013,微軟也對Python有所支援,自然使用vs來搭載了 1.安裝vs

python django web項目的構建步驟(二)

標籤:python   mysql   django   django web   視圖的實現:視圖是一個簡單的 Python 方法,它接受一個請求對象,負責實現:任何商務邏輯(直接或間接)上下文字典,它包含模板資料使用一個上下文來表示模板響應對象,它將所表示的結果返回到這個架構中在 Django 中,當一個 URL 被請求時,所調用的 Python

Python菜鳥的Hadoop實戰——Hadoop2.6.0中的Yarn

標籤:hadoop2.6.0 yarn jobtracker tasktracker resourcemanager nodemanager上一篇文章——Hadoop2.6.0叢集部署中,我們可以看到,Hadoop叢集啟動後的服務情況:[[email protected] ~]$ jps27888 SecondaryNameNode27688 NameNode28430 Jps28044 ResourceManager31

python物件導向

標籤:# -*- coding: utf-8 -*-class Person:    ‘‘‘a doc string for you class‘‘‘    population = 0    def __init__(self,name):        ‘‘‘initial the

總頁數: 2974 1 .... 2897 2898 2899 2900 2901 .... 2974 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.